Ticket TL-442: The staging instance of Chronoplan, our school timetable solver, was deployed with the production solver queue credentials. This means staging runs can enqueue jobs against live district schedules at Hollowbrook Academy. We need to rotate the affected credential and point staging at its own queue. For the security review, note that the fix requires updating the staging .env with the following line:

vault entry, tagug-hahip: ARCHIVE_KEY3=e34

// Watchdog setup for the Perchpoint kiosk app.
// If the UI freezes for 30s, this client pings the Nudgework
// restart service, which power-cycles the display process.
// Support folks: don't disable this, even if a kiosk keeps
// rebooting — file a ticket instead. The client authenticates
// to Nudgework with the key below.

service key, yadug-bajog: zpat3_pou

Handover Note — Pricing, Meridew Line

Hi, and welcome. Quick context on Meridew pricing: we moved to tiered bundles last spring and margins improved, but the entry tier is still loss-leading in the Calvert region. Resist pressure from sales to discount further — Orven, my predecessor, caved and it took a year to unwind. Full model lives with Priya. The confidential pricing strategy follows below.

board note of kafog-bajep: Briathek Partners is in early talks to buy Aldaelek Group for about $47.1 million. The Ulaath launch date is September 4, and nothing goes to the press before then.

Welcome to DedupeDeck, our on-call alert deduplicator. It collapses duplicate pages within a five-minute window using a fingerprint of source, severity, and resource. Most changes only touch the fingerprint rules in rules.toml. Deploys go through the Lanternway pipeline, and every artifact must be signed before promotion. Sign release builds with the key below.

release key, kawif-hawep: bky13_X7TGuRG4Zu4ZJ

Severity: High. The Lenaro payments module converts via floating-point intermediate values, producing off-by-one-cent errors on EUR→JPY paths when amounts exceed six digits. Cumulative drift across batch settlements reached 0.4% in the Varick test ledger. Security concern: an attacker could structure repeated micro-conversions to skim rounding remainders. Fix should move to integer minor-units with banker's rounding at the final step only. Repro steps attached to the ticket. The affected build's trace token follows.

trace token, fafog-kageg: htk4_98e6